Job Description
The engineer develops scalable vehicle-simulation components and validates virtual vehicle models with GM dynamics and actuation specialists.
Responsibilities
Model vehicle ECUs, actuators, chassis and tyres.
Develop scalable vehicle-simulation architectures.
Collaborate with vehicle-dynamics and actuation engineers.
Design and execute model-validation studies.
Analyse simulation and physical-test results.
Optimise simulation software performance and maintainability.
Eligibility
B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ering, applied physics, aerospace engineering, computer science or a related field.
At least three years of vehicle-modelling experience.
Expertise in vehicle-system modelling and simulation.
Strong Python and C or C++ programming skills.
Experience with MATLAB, Simulink and model validation.
